From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.2 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H,MAILING_LIST_MULTI, SIGNED_OFF_BY,SPF_PASS,UNWANTED_LANGUAGE_BODY,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id BBC22C10F0E for ; Fri, 12 Apr 2019 16:15:39 +0000 (UTC)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 8D2D320850 for ; Fri, 12 Apr 2019 16:15:39 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="kCVR/7K3"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 8D2D320850 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=pengutronix.de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:Mime-Version:References:In-Reply-To: Date:To:From:Subject:Message-ID: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=cC1I4HKF0KTyzOy+k6WpumylgtuBrq89bH87e0H7+og=; b=kCVR/7K3caS3bS nesc+4b12Wm7HpLh9Q3hkt9yxnpGcBeF/XoqBQL8WilGDleSvFMDOQqCK5JW74jMN2cqbe7KiampD Pw3XLKh8qcDfIOXtP7mE6Ujd4R5xNeh8htTfXS+PKSdFyMeK3ETE327J+qiublV5m67Nl8tUt2j7E 5QuNrPW4+AMI0fAjD1y4bJbFbTSUpsjGNm2kNNdSGNvO82P5H7vGbqzqC15CtZnbUp1/l9niN7ESB 46kozMPPGM8zO8aXKsm6rcrdHBZTN3ZTZmW0kRzwME0ISYtM/ZdVim4c2Bbaqet9kIdoZFnfo7M3R W/Zo+CxoMaJbINE06/Pw==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1hEypz-0006Mm-Hv; Fri, 12 Apr 2019 16:15:35 +0000 Received: from metis.ext.pengutronix.de ([2001:67c:670:201:290:27ff:fe1d:cc33]) by bombadil.infradead.org with esmtps (Exim 4.90_1 #2 (Red Hat Linux)) id 1hEypw-0006MT-IM for linux-arm-kernel@lists.infradead.org; Fri, 12 Apr 2019 16:15:34 +0000 Received: from kresse.hi.pengutronix.de ([2001:67c:670:100:1d::2a]) by metis.ext.pengutronix.de with esmtp (Exim 4.89) (envelope-from ) id 1hEypp-0003kY-6L; Fri, 12 Apr 2019 18:15:25 +0200 Message-ID: <1555085724.11529.37.camel@pengutronix.de> Subject: Re: [PATCH v3 09/11] PCI: imx6: Restrict PHY register data to 16-bit From: Lucas Stach To: Andrey Smirnov , linux-pci@vger.kernel.org Date: Fri, 12 Apr 2019 18:15:24 +0200 In-Reply-To: <20190401042547.14067-10-andrew.smirnov@gmail.com> References: <20190401042547.14067-1-andrew.smirnov@gmail.com> <20190401042547.14067-10-andrew.smirnov@gmail.com> X-Mailer: Evolution 3.22.6-1+deb9u1 Mime-Version: 1.0 X-SA-Exim-Connect-IP: 2001:67c:670:100:1d::2a X-SA-Exim-Mail-From: l.stach@pengutronix.de X-SA-Exim-Scanned: No (on metis.ext.pengutronix.de); SAEximRunCond expanded to false X-PTX-Original-Recipient: linux-arm-kernel@lists.infradead.org X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20190412_091532_764364_3B9AD685 X-CRM114-Status: GOOD ( 14.60 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: "A.s. Dong" , Lorenzo Pieralisi , Richard Zhu , linux-kernel@vger.kernel.org, Fabio Estevam , linux-imx@nxp.com, Bjorn Helgaas , Leonard Crestez , Chris Healy , linux-arm-kernel@lists.infradead.org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org QW0gU29ubnRhZywgZGVuIDMxLjAzLjIwMTksIDIxOjI1IC0wNzAwIHNjaHJpZWIgQW5kcmV5IFNt aXJub3Y6Cj4gUEhZIHJlZ2lzdGVycyBvbiBpLk1YNiBhcmUgMTYtYml0IHdpZGUsIHNvIHdlIGNh biBnZXQgcmlkIG9mIGV4cGxpY2l0Cj4gbWFza2luZyBpZiB3ZSByZXN0cmljdCBwY2llX3BoeV9y ZWFkL3BjaWVfcGh5X3dyaXRlIHRvIHVzZSAndTE2Jwo+IGluc3RlYWQgb2YgJ2ludCcuIE5vIGZ1 bmN0aW9uYWwgY2hhbmdlIGludGVuZGVkLgo+IAo+ID4gQ2M6IExvcmVuem8gUGllcmFsaXNpIDxs b3JlbnpvLnBpZXJhbGlzaUBhcm0uY29tPgo+ID4gQ2M6IEJqb3JuIEhlbGdhYXMgPGJoZWxnYWFz QGdvb2dsZS5jb20+Cj4gPiBDYzogRmFiaW8gRXN0ZXZhbSA8ZmFiaW8uZXN0ZXZhbUBueHAuY29t Pgo+ID4gQ2M6IENocmlzIEhlYWx5IDxjcGhlYWx5QGdtYWlsLmNvbT4KPiA+IENjOiBMdWNhcyBT dGFjaCA8bC5zdGFjaEBwZW5ndXRyb25peC5kZT4KPiA+IENjOiBMZW9uYXJkIENyZXN0ZXogPGxl b25hcmQuY3Jlc3RlekBueHAuY29tPgo+ID4gQ2M6ICJBLnMuIERvbmciIDxhaXNoZW5nLmRvbmdA bnhwLmNvbT4KPiA+IENjOiBSaWNoYXJkIFpodSA8aG9uZ3hpbmcuemh1QG54cC5jb20+Cj4gQ2M6 IGxpbnV4LWlteEBueHAuY29tCj4gQ2M6IGxpbnV4LWFybS1rZXJuZWxAbGlzdHMuaW5mcmFkZWFk Lm9yZwo+IENjOiBsaW51eC1rZXJuZWxAdmdlci5rZXJuZWwub3JnCj4gQ2M6IGxpbnV4LXBjaUB2 Z2VyLmtlcm5lbC5vcmcKPiBTaWduZWQtb2ZmLWJ5OiBBbmRyZXkgU21pcm5vdiA8YW5kcmV3LnNt aXJub3ZAZ21haWwuY29tPgoKUmV2aWV3ZWQtYnk6IEx1Y2FzIFN0YWNoIDxsLnN0YWNoQHBlbmd1 dHJvbml4LmRlPgoKPiAtLS0KPiDCoGRyaXZlcnMvcGNpL2NvbnRyb2xsZXIvZHdjL3BjaS1pbXg2 LmMgfCAxMyArKysrKystLS0tLS0tCj4gwqAxIGZpbGUgY2hhbmdlZCwgNiBpbnNlcnRpb25zKCsp LCA3IGRlbGV0aW9ucygtKQo+IAo+IGRpZmYgLS1naXQgYS9kcml2ZXJzL3BjaS9jb250cm9sbGVy L2R3Yy9wY2ktaW14Ni5jIGIvZHJpdmVycy9wY2kvY29udHJvbGxlci9kd2MvcGNpLWlteDYuYwo+ IGluZGV4IDdjM2ZmYjc1MTAwMi4uOWM2NThlZjU1YWE0IDEwMDY0NAo+IC0tLSBhL2RyaXZlcnMv cGNpL2NvbnRyb2xsZXIvZHdjL3BjaS1pbXg2LmMKPiArKysgYi9kcml2ZXJzL3BjaS9jb250cm9s bGVyL2R3Yy9wY2ktaW14Ni5jCj4gQEAgLTE5NSwxMCArMTk1LDEwIEBAIHN0YXRpYyBpbnQgcGNp ZV9waHlfd2FpdF9hY2soc3RydWN0IGlteDZfcGNpZSAqaW14Nl9wY2llLCBpbnQgYWRkcikKPiDC oH0KPiDCoAo+IMKgLyogUmVhZCBmcm9tIHRoZSAxNi1iaXQgUENJZSBQSFkgY29udHJvbCByZWdp c3RlcnMgKG5vdCBtZW1vcnktbWFwcGVkKSAqLwo+IC1zdGF0aWMgaW50IHBjaWVfcGh5X3JlYWQo c3RydWN0IGlteDZfcGNpZSAqaW14Nl9wY2llLCBpbnQgYWRkciwgaW50ICpkYXRhKQo+ICtzdGF0 aWMgaW50IHBjaWVfcGh5X3JlYWQoc3RydWN0IGlteDZfcGNpZSAqaW14Nl9wY2llLCBpbnQgYWRk ciwgdTE2ICpkYXRhKQo+IMKgewo+ID4gwqAJc3RydWN0IGR3X3BjaWUgKnBjaSA9IGlteDZfcGNp ZS0+cGNpOwo+ID4gLQl1MzIgdmFsLCBwaHlfY3RsOwo+ID4gKwl1MzIgcGh5X2N0bDsKPiA+IMKg CWludCByZXQ7Cj4gwqAKPiA+IMKgCXJldCA9IHBjaWVfcGh5X3dhaXRfYWNrKGlteDZfcGNpZSwg YWRkcik7Cj4gQEAgLTIxMyw4ICsyMTMsNyBAQCBzdGF0aWMgaW50IHBjaWVfcGh5X3JlYWQoc3Ry dWN0IGlteDZfcGNpZSAqaW14Nl9wY2llLCBpbnQgYWRkciwgaW50ICpkYXRhKQo+ID4gwqAJaWYg KHJldCkKPiA+IMKgCQlyZXR1cm4gcmV0Owo+IMKgCj4gPiAtCXZhbCA9IGR3X3BjaWVfcmVhZGxf ZGJpKHBjaSwgUENJRV9QSFlfU1RBVCk7Cj4gPiAtCSpkYXRhID0gdmFsICYgMHhmZmZmOwo+ID4g KwkqZGF0YSA9IGR3X3BjaWVfcmVhZGxfZGJpKHBjaSwgUENJRV9QSFlfU1RBVCk7Cj4gwqAKPiA+ IMKgCS8qIGRlYXNzZXJ0IFJlYWQgc2lnbmFsICovCj4gPiDCoAlkd19wY2llX3dyaXRlbF9kYmko cGNpLCBQQ0lFX1BIWV9DVFJMLCAweDAwKTsKPiBAQCAtMjIyLDcgKzIyMSw3IEBAIHN0YXRpYyBp bnQgcGNpZV9waHlfcmVhZChzdHJ1Y3QgaW14Nl9wY2llICppbXg2X3BjaWUsIGludCBhZGRyLCBp bnQgKmRhdGEpCj4gPiDCoAlyZXR1cm4gcGNpZV9waHlfcG9sbF9hY2soaW14Nl9wY2llLCAwKTsK PiDCoH0KPiDCoAo+IC1zdGF0aWMgaW50IHBjaWVfcGh5X3dyaXRlKHN0cnVjdCBpbXg2X3BjaWUg KmlteDZfcGNpZSwgaW50IGFkZHIsIGludCBkYXRhKQo+ICtzdGF0aWMgaW50IHBjaWVfcGh5X3dy aXRlKHN0cnVjdCBpbXg2X3BjaWUgKmlteDZfcGNpZSwgaW50IGFkZHIsIHUxNiBkYXRhKQo+IMKg ewo+ID4gwqAJc3RydWN0IGR3X3BjaWUgKnBjaSA9IGlteDZfcGNpZS0+cGNpOwo+ID4gwqAJdTMy IHZhcjsKPiBAQCAtMjc5LDcgKzI3OCw3IEBAIHN0YXRpYyBpbnQgcGNpZV9waHlfd3JpdGUoc3Ry dWN0IGlteDZfcGNpZSAqaW14Nl9wY2llLCBpbnQgYWRkciwgaW50IGRhdGEpCj4gwqAKPiDCoHN0 YXRpYyB2b2lkIGlteDZfcGNpZV9yZXNldF9waHkoc3RydWN0IGlteDZfcGNpZSAqaW14Nl9wY2ll KQo+IMKgewo+ID4gLQl1MzIgdG1wOwo+ID4gKwl1MTYgdG1wOwo+IMKgCj4gPiDCoAlpZiAoIShp bXg2X3BjaWUtPmRydmRhdGEtPmZsYWdzICYgSU1YNl9QQ0lFX0ZMQUdfSU1YNl9QSFkpKQo+ID4g wqAJCXJldHVybjsKPiBAQCAtNjc1LDcgKzY3NCw3IEBAIHN0YXRpYyBpbnQgaW14Nl9zZXR1cF9w aHlfbXBsbChzdHJ1Y3QgaW14Nl9wY2llICppbXg2X3BjaWUpCj4gwqB7Cj4gPiDCoAl1bnNpZ25l ZCBsb25nIHBoeV9yYXRlID0gY2xrX2dldF9yYXRlKGlteDZfcGNpZS0+cGNpZV9waHkpOwo+ID4g wqAJaW50IG11bHQsIGRpdjsKPiA+IC0JdTMyIHZhbDsKPiA+ICsJdTE2IHZhbDsKPiDCoAo+ID4g wqAJaWYgKCEoaW14Nl9wY2llLT5kcnZkYXRhLT5mbGFncyAmIElNWDZfUENJRV9GTEFHX0lNWDZf UEhZKSkKPiA+IMKgCQlyZXR1cm4gMDsKC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fCmxpbnV4LWFybS1rZXJuZWwgbWFpbGluZyBsaXN0CmxpbnV4LWFybS1r ZXJuZWxAbGlzdHMuaW5mcmFkZWFkLm9yZwpodHRwOi8vbGlzdHMuaW5mcmFkZWFkLm9yZy9tYWls bWFuL2xpc3RpbmZvL2xpbnV4LWFybS1rZXJuZWwK